Elevating Your Garden Experience with Raised Beds

Unlocking the Potential of Vertical Gardening

Gardening enthusiasts often face challenges when it comes to limited space or poor soil quality. However, with raised garden beds, these limitations can be overcome. Raised beds provide an opportunity to create a lush garden in the sky, allowing for efficient use of space and optimal growing conditions.

Maximizing Space Efficiency

One of the primary benefits of raised garden beds is their ability to maximize space efficiency. By elevating the garden above ground level, vertical space is utilized effectively, allowing for more plants to be grown in a smaller area. This is particularly advantageous for urban dwellers or those with limited yard space, as it enables them to enjoy the benefits of gardening without the need for a sprawling backyard.

Optimal Growing Conditions

Raised garden beds also offer optimal growing conditions for plants. The elevated nature of the beds allows for better drainage, preventing waterlogging and root rot. Additionally, gardeners have more control over the soil quality, enabling them to customize the soil mixture to suit the specific needs of their plants. This results in healthier, more vibrant growth and increased yields.

Choosing the Right Plants

When planning your raised garden layout, it’s important to consider the types of plants you want to grow. While virtually any plant can thrive in a raised bed, some are better suited to vertical gardening than others. Consider selecting compact or trailing varieties that can thrive in confined spaces, such as herbs, salad greens, strawberries, and compact vegetables like cherry tomatoes and peppers.

Maintenance Tips for Success

To ensure the success of your raised garden layout, proper maintenance is essential. Regular watering, pruning, and fertilizing will help keep your plants healthy and thriving. Additionally, be sure to monitor for pests and diseases, as elevated gardens can sometimes be more susceptible to these issues. Embrace Rustic Charm

When it comes to enhancing the beauty of your outdoor space, nothing quite compares to the rustic charm of a pallet walkway. These creative and eco-friendly pathways not only add character to your garden but also provide a functional and visually appealing way to navigate your landscape. Let’s delve into some inspiring pallet walkway inspirations to transform your outdoor oasis.

Upcycled Elegance: Transforming Old Pallets

One of the most appealing aspects of creating a pallet walkway is the opportunity to upcycle old pallets. Instead of letting them go to waste, repurpose them into stunning pathways that blend seamlessly with nature. Whether you leave the wood in its natural state or give it a fresh coat of paint, the rustic elegance of upcycled pallets adds a touch of charm to any garden.

Budget-Friendly Beauty: Cost-Effective Solutions

Another advantage of pallet walkways is their affordability. Unlike expensive paving materials like stone or brick, pallets can be obtained for free or at minimal cost from local businesses or online classifieds. With a little creativity and elbow grease, you can create a stunning pathway that rivals those found in high-end gardens, without breaking the bank.
